Abstract
Jeptha Harris, as administrator of the estate of William Woods, alleges that Willis Wall and Edmond H. Brewer owe him fifty-five dollars, plus interest, "for the hire of a negro fellow Limas." Harris further states that Wall and Brewer "obliged themselves to furnish Said boy Limas with two good Suits of new clothes ... one pair of good strong shoes one Duffle Blanket of good size one new hat" as well as pay the taxes due on Limas. Contending that they have not honored any of these obligations, Harris sues for $100 in damages.
Result: Partially granted.
